		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>That&#8217;s right.  The NES games are available to &#8220;ambassadors&#8221; through the 3DS eShop under the settings, download history menu.  The GBA titles will be available the same way.  Basically instead of Nintendo placing them where non-ambassador&#8217;s can see them they are conveniently adding them to your account downloads so that you can (re) download them anytime.  I read an article a while back saying that you didn&#8217;t necessarily need to have connected to the eShop prior to the date given this summer.  If you could provide a receipt or proof that you paid the higher $250 price, Nintendo would add you to the program after the fact.  I can say the NES titles are great, but the GBA selection looks even better collectively.  As far as the NES titles the writer could be referring to the fact that Nintendo had recently stated some of the NES titles already available will be receiving two-player updated versions soon.  </p>
